The 60 did really well on the trails I went on. The only real issue were the steep drops and climbs where I drug the bumper, but there was no choice (rear bumper). This time I did not drag the front bumper that bad, although it took some grinding too. A few times I know I just missed the rocks on the front by a mere inch or two. The rear was a different story..came down hard on the rear bumper more than once. I think the trail was called metal bender....a couple of rather steep decents and drops where I paid some dues. From my time there and what I read issues in our crew....some axle breakage, leaf spring break, driveshaft issue, broken windshield and other stuff, fuel pump issue, fan belts, radiator, death wobble... everyone made it home...plenty of scrapes and pin-strips and a few dents all around.

I was surprised that the 60 did fairly well on a couple of the lighter duty trails. The traction on the rocks was incredible in comparison to TN and areas in the south. Front and Rear lockers and decent tires made all the difference out in MOAB, for the stuff the larger trucks could handle..some places it seemed it was a little nerve racking on the short wheel base guys in comparison to the longer wheel base 60 and Jason's 4runner.
